"A charming two bedroom character victorian property situated in a very convenient residential location in Poole. The property is offered in beautiful condition and retains many of its original character features.

Entrance Porch Reception Hall Lounge/Dining Room 25 x 12' narrowing to 11" Feature Kitchen/Breakfast Room 19' x 8' Conservatory 9' x 5' Bedroom One 14' x 12' Bedroom Two 12' x 9'10 Feature Bathroom 12' x 8' Low Maintenance Southerly Aspect Rear Garden Off Road Parking Character Victorian Property

UPVC double glazed door into 

ENTRANCE PORCH Quarry tiled character flooring. External light. Original stained glass front door into

RECEPTION HALL Coved ceiling. Light point. Panelled radiator. Trip switch. Meter cupboard. Door to 

LOUNGE/DINING ROOM 25' x 12' narrowing to 11' in the dining area (7.62m x 3.66m narrowing to 3.35m in the dining area) Lounge: Period cast iron fireplace with a pine fire surround with matching mantel. Tiled hearth. Fitted gas fire. Coved ceiling. Light point. TV point. Panelled radiator. UPVC double glazed windows to front aspect. Dining Area: Coved ceiling. Light point. Panelled radiator. Understairs storage cupboard. Window to rear aspect. Original door with attractive stainless glass into

FEATURE KITCHEN/BREAKFAST ROOM 19' x 8' (5.79m x 2.44m) Excellent range of Shaker style eye and base level cupboards and drawers with surrounding work surfaces. Tiled splashbacks. Single drainer bowl and a quarter sink unit. Housing for fridge/freezer. Integrated oven, hob, extractor. Plumbing for washing machine. Space for tumble dryer. Display cabinet. Panelled radiator. Space for breakfast table. UPVC double glazed windows to side aspect. Picture window to rear aspect. Door to

CONSERVATORY 9' x 5' (2.74m x 1.52m) UPVC double glazed french doors give access onto the rear. 

Stairs from reception to

FIRST FLOOR LANDING Original pine balustrades. Coved ceiling. Light point. Loft access with ladder, part boarded. Radiator. Skylight. Built-in storage cupboard. Original pine doors from first floor landing to two double bedrooms and spacious bathroom.

BEDROOM ONE 14' x 12' into recess (4.27m x 3.66m into recess) Excellent range of built-in bedroom furniture incorporating floor to ceiling double wardrobe, two single wardrobes, three further double wardrobes. Chest of drawers. Bedside cabinets. Coved ceiling. Light point. Double panelled radiator. TV point. UPVC double glazed windows to front aspect.

BEDROOM TWO 12' x 9'10 (3.66m x 3m) Floor to ceiling fitted wardrobe. Fitted dressing table/desk. Light point. Panelled radiator. UPVC double glazed window to rear aspect. 

FEATURE BATHROOM 12' x 8' (3.66m x 2.44m) Modern white suite comprising wood side panelled bath with chrome mixer taps, fitted shower with rail and curtain. Fully tiled bath area. Pedestal wash hand basin. WC. Bidet. Fully tiled floor. Airing cupboard. Radiator. Coved ceiling. Light point. UPVC double glazed crittall window to rear aspect.

The outside of the Property

FRONT GARDEN Brick pillared entrance with concrete pathway. Flagstone patio. Surrounding border. 

REAR GARDEN The rear garden has been designed with low maintenance in mind with a brick paviour pathway leading to courtyard garden. Raised shrub borders. External tap. Palm tree. Grapevine. The rear garden enjoys a southerly aspect. Trellising with archway to the side leads to

OFF ROAD PARKING Off road parking is accessible via the rear through double opening doors. Off road parking for one car. Timber shed to remain.
